The chief circuit judge of Daviess County, Judge Lisa Payne Jones, has been appointed to Kentucky's First District Court of Appeals.

Payne will fill the vacancy of Judge Donna Dixon of Paducah, who resigned from the post last November.

Jones was one of three nominees submitted to Governor Andy Beshear by the bi-partisan Judicial Nominating Committee.

Jones will be sworn in April 29th in Daviess County. 

Fourteen judges, two elected from seven appellate court districts, serve on the Court of Appeals. The judges are divided into panels of three to review and decide cases. The panels do not sit permanently in one location, but travel about the state to hear cases.
